Output 40518038a56ae7c36a00c0a75cb96e060d9d9b9d13f463ce1eac14e5db8d574e:0

value
136053541
script pubkey
OP_0 OP_PUSHBYTES_20 3b12445c801b5b14fa4351ba5968f9cd0368253e
address
ltc1q8vfyghyqrdd3f7jr2xa9j68ee5pksff7ue3de9
transaction
40518038a56ae7c36a00c0a75cb96e060d9d9b9d13f463ce1eac14e5db8d574e
spent
true